Chromosomes
Structures consisting of DNA and proteins, found in the nucleus of cells, carrying genetic information in the form of genes.
Hershey And Chase
Scientists who conducted experiments in 1952, using bacteriophages to show that DNA, not protein, is the genetic material of viruses.
Hereditary Material
Genetic material, such as DNA or RNA, that is passed from parents to offspring and determines inherited traits.
Avery, MacLeod, And McCarty
Scientists who demonstrated that DNA is the substance that causes bacterial transformation, establishing the role of DNA in heredity.
